STANDARDS & CERTIFICATESPowerflex RV-K is a 0,6/1kV cable in accordance with International Standard IEC 60502-1, widely used throughout Europe. The cable is Aenor, Bureau Veritas, Kema-Keur and CB Certified.

ELECTRICAL PERFORMANCEThe specific design of the Powerflex RV-K com-pound materials means it can be installed in al-most all types of environmental conditions such as dry, wet areas, direct burial, outdoors and even immersed in water.

WEATHER RESISTANCEThe special PVC UV-protected outer sheath also provides excellent weather resistance and can be installed outdoors without damaging the lifespan of the cable installation.

IMMERSIBILITYPowerflex RV-K can withstand damp conditions including total immersion in water (AD7), and also hot water. On the other side, copper con-ductors withstand moisture much better than any other conductor.

METER BY METER MARKINGFor easy handling in installations and better stock management.

COST-EFFECTIVEPowerflex RV-K cables not only exceed the performance characteristics required in today’s European industrial markets, but they do so in a cost-effective way, as it requires less time and manpower when they are being installed and they have much higher current capacity than standard 70ºC cables.

OVERLOAD CAPACITYPowerflex RV-K cables withstand short-circuit temperatures up to 250ºC, much higher than PVC insulated cables (only 160ºC), at identical cross-section.

FIRE CONDITIONSPERFORMANCEPowerflex cables are flame retardant (*), meeting IEC 60332-1 combustion testing requirements.

CHEMICAL RESISTANCEThe special PVC outer sheath provides an excellent protection against acid and base alkaline substances.

MAX SERVICETEMPERATURE: 90ºCThe cross-linked polyethylene insulation (XLPE) raises the maximum conductor temperature to 90ºC (vs 70ºC in type NYY or PVC insulated cables).

MIN SERVICETEMPERATURE: -40ºCPowerflex RV-K is designed to operate reliably even at -40ºC in fixed installations (vs -15ºC in the most common cables in the European market).

FLEXIBILITYThe use of Class 5 flexible copper conductors and flexible compounds makes Powerflex RV-K highly flexible. Flexible copper conductors don’t creep under vibration conditions.

DESIGN

ConductorElectrolytic copper, class 5 (flexible), based on

EN 60228 and IEC 60228.

InsulationCross-linked polyethylene (XLPE)

The standard identification of insulated conductors is the following:

1 x Natural 2 x Blue + Brown 3 G Blue + Brown + Green/yellow 3 x Brown + Black + Grey 3 x + 1 x Brown + Black + Grey + Blue (reduced cross-section) 4 G Brown + Black + Grey + Green/yellow 4 x Brown + Black + Grey + Blue 5 G Brown + Black + Grey + Blue + Green/yellow

Outer sheathFlexible PVC, black colour.

APPLICATIONSPowerflex RV-K cable is suitable for all types of low voltage industrial-type connec-tions, in urban grids, building installations, etc. Its high flexibility makes the installation process substantially easier and, as a result, is particularly suitable for use in difficult layouts. It can be buried or installed in a tube as well as outdoors without requiring ad-ditional protection. This cable can withstand damp conditions including total immersion in water (AD7).

CHARACTERISTICS

Electrical performanceLOW VOLTAGE 0,6/1kV

StandardIEC 60502-1 - UNE 21123-2

ApprovalsCESECBUREAU VERITASAENORSASORoHSKEMA KEUR

Eca

Thermal performanceMaximum service temperature: 90ºC.Maximum short-circuit temperature: 250ºC (max. 5 s).Minimum service temperature: -40ºC (fixed and protected installations).

Fire performanceFlame non-propagation based on UNE-EN 60332-1 and IEC 60332-1.Reduced emission of halogens. Chlorine <15%.Reaction to fire CPR: Eca, according to EN 50575.

Mechanical performanceMinimum bending radius: x5 cable diameter.Impact resistance: AG2 Medium severity.

Chemical performanceChemical & Oil resistance: Good.UV Resistant: UNE 211605.

Water performanceWater resistance: AD7 Immersion

OtherMeter by meter marking.

Installation conditionsOpen Air.Buried.In conduit.

ApplicationsIndustrial use.Urban grids.

PackagingAvailable in coils (lengths of 100 m) and drums.
